Output 52346245c4e56e65e6b10309d023b5d87ca1d933e38cf8ee6db73fedef76d2a2:1

value
9483602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a1ed5d6e25466b9d970617562fbf94a9aaaeeba OP_EQUAL
address
32cXcwJCqXXyWrCsaNPKY1cc8KzfEf6aXu
transaction
52346245c4e56e65e6b10309d023b5d87ca1d933e38cf8ee6db73fedef76d2a2
spent
true